~ RULES ~

  1. All matches are played on the balanced scenarios created for the original Top Dog matches, with Cats playing Scenario #1 and Dogs playing Scenario #2.  See below.
  2. Each game is a mirror match, with the winner being determined by the points differential of the combined games.
  3. In the interests of keeping the tournament progressing at a reasonable pace you are STRONGLY ENCOURAGED to play the games of each match simultaneously rather than back to back.
  4. The results of each game (including the victory points for each game) should be forwarded to Generals Gast and Barlow for recording and posting on the tournament website.
  5. Each species has been randomly paired to create a tournament ladder, which will be a single elimination ladder.
  6. Last man standing in each species will play for the honor of being the Top ___ (guess we'll have to wait to find out what goes in the blank, won't we?).  This will be a mirror match of sorts, but that the players will play both games (#1 & #2), with the winner of each species choosing the side in their game. In other words, the Top Cat chooses the side in Scenario #1 and the Top Dog chooses the side in Scenario #2.

~ SCENARIOS ~

1. (Cats) Mirrored match on Prairie Grove map (BGS/Pg) - 15 turns

10,000 men on each side, completely equal in all respects, leaders are of same rating with equal command and leadership radius. No objectives, starting with draw result.  Download and expand TDPG.zip into BGS/Pg directory to play, to reinstall the original files, download and expand Mainoriginal.zip

2. (Dogs) Mirrored match on Wilson creek map (BGS/Wc) - 12 turns

Around 6000 men on each side, completely equal in all respects, leaders are of same rating with equal command and leadership radius. No objectives, starting with draw result.  Download and expand TDWC.zip into BGS/Wc directory to play, to reinstall the original files, download and expand Mainorig.zip
